The contract involves the pruning of 33 trees in accordance with International Society of Arboriculture best practices to maintain tree health, ensure public safety, and enhance the visual appeal of the site. The work is being procured as a subcontract under a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business set-aside, specifically designated for SDVOSBs as defined under FAR 19.14. The North American Industry Classification System code for this procurement is 238910, aligning with site preparation and other specialty trade contractors. The performance location is identified with a zip code of 04330, though the exact city and state are not specified. The solicitation was posted on July 31, 2026, with a response deadline of August 21, 2026, at 8:00 PM. The contracting entity is the National Cemetery Administration under the Department of Veterans Affairs, indicating the work will be conducted at a veterans' cemetery or related federal property under their stewardship.

Combined Synopsis Solicitation Camp Butler National Cemetery Janitorial
Solicitation # 36C78626Q50230
The contract solicitation is for janitorial services at Camp Butler National Cemetery in Springfield, Illinois, under a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business (SDVOSB) set-aside, with NAICS code 561720. Proposals are due by August 14, 2026, and the work is anticipated to begin on September 1, 2026, with a one-year base period and four one-year option periods, contingent on funding availability. The solicitation follows a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) evaluation process, where technical acceptability is mandatory and determines eligibility for award regardless of price, with selection going to the lowest-priced offeror who meets all threshold requirements. Offerors must be registered in SAM.gov, hold a valid UEI, and self-certify as an SDVOSB through that system. Technical proposals must demonstrate a clear, tailored understanding of the Performance Work Statement, including compliance with Green Cleaning standards, adherence to VA and OSHA regulations, and submission of a Quality Control Plan within 14 days of award. Personnel must be properly trained, and the contract manager must have at least three years of experience managing custodial services for large facilities. All contractor staff must follow strict behavioral and dress codes while on government premises, and prohibited items such as steel wool and abrasive cleaners are banned. Contractor responsibilities include daily restroom sanitation, trash removal, monthly cleaning of light fixtures, quarterly window cleaning, bi-annual HVAC register cleaning, and holiday support at the Public Information Building, all governed by strict defect thresholds—no more than four monthly defects for general cleaning, and zero for periodic and grounds cleaning. Deficiencies must be corrected within one day, or within two hours if urgent. The contractor must submit weekly performance reports, use only bio-based and non-corrosive cleaning chemicals, and provide Safety Data Sheets for all products before use. Equipment must be marked, stored appropriately, and disinfected daily, with no use of inappropriate containers. Invoicing must be electronic, comply with FAR 52.212-4(g), and include contract-specific data, though the exact invoicing platform is not specified. The contract includes clauses on whistleblower rights, subcontracting limitations, prohibited contracting with inverted domestic corporations, suspension/debarment protections, and electronic payment submissions.
